This is an extraordinary puzzle by Grafika with the impressive artwork The Execution of Lady Jane Grey, by Paul Delaroche. You can admire the original painting at the National Gallery, in London.

The puzzle is COMPLETE (1520 pieces). The pieces are in excellent condition. The box is in very good condition.

Grafika also published a 1000 piece version of this puzzle.

More information about The Execution of Lady Jane Grey:
  • Puzzle size: 68.5 x 70 cm.
  • Box size: 35 x 22.2 x 4.3 cm.
  • Reference number: 00752.
  • EAN number: 3663384007521.
